Tunisia - Green Chillies and Green Peppers Harvested Area
Since 2014, Tunisia Green Chillies and Green Peppers Harvested Area fell by 0.7%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 13 among other countries in Green Chillies and Green Peppers Harvested Area at 20,103 Hectares. Tunisia is overtaken by Spain, which was ranked number 12 with 21,430 Hectares and is followed by United States at 19,627 Hectares. China lead the ranking with 798,877 Hectares in 2019, that is a growth of 1.4% versus 2018. Indonesia, Mexico and Nigeria resp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Portugal witnessed the best average annual growth at +64.2% per year, while Ethiopia witnessed the worst performance at -35% per year.
